アーティクル - CS274461
SSO を有効にすると ThingWorx アプリケーションの起動に失敗する
修正日: 05-Mar-2025
適用対象
- Windchill Navigate (formerly ThingWorx Navigate) 1.5.0 F000
- ThingWorx Platform 8.4 F000 to 9.6
説明
- ThingWorxはSSOなしで動作していた
- platform-settings.jsonでEnableSSO: trueを設定して SSO を有効にした後、ThingWorx が起動に失敗する
- ThingWorx ログにエラー メッセージが表示されます:
原因: com.thingworx.security.sso.SSOConfigurationException: Grants テーブルが存在しません
[ Grants テーブルが存在しません ][ エラー: リレーション "oauth_client_token" が存在しません_ 位置: 51 ]
[ Grants テーブルが存在しません ][ エラー: リレーション "oauth_client_token" が存在しません_ 位置: 51 ]
- ApplicationLog.logに以下のエラーが表示されます:
2019-07-30 12:28:21.305+0200 [L: ERROR] [O: SctsasSSOSettings] [I: ] [U: SuperUser] [S: ] [T: localhost-startStop-1] [ Grants テーブルが存在しません ][ オブジェクト名 'OAUTH_CLIENT_TOKEN' が無効です。 ]
2019-07-30 12:28:21.305+0200 [L: ERROR] [O: SctwcThreadLocalContext] [I: ] [U: SuperUser] [S: ] [T: localhost-startStop-1] SSOContext の取得に失敗しました
2019-07-30 12:28:21.305+0200 [L: ERROR] [O: SctsasSSOBootstrapper] [I: ] [U: SuperUser] [S: ] [T: localhost-startStop-1] カスタム コンテキスト ローダー リスナーで重大なエラーが発生しました: SSOContext を取得できませんでした
2019-07-30 12:28:21.305+0200 [L: ERROR] [O: SctwcThreadLocalContext] [I: ] [U: SuperUser] [S: ] [T: localhost-startStop-1] SSOContext の取得に失敗しました
2019-07-30 12:28:21.305+0200 [L: ERROR] [O: SctsasSSOBootstrapper] [I: ] [U: SuperUser] [S: ] [T: localhost-startStop-1] カスタム コンテキスト ローダー リスナーで重大なエラーが発生しました: SSOContext を取得できませんでした
最新バージョンはこちらを参照ください CS274461